Matsuzawa to talk in Stirling
Dear friends and colleagues I am delighted to announce that Professor Tetsuro Matsuzawa will be giving a presentation at the University of Stirling. Professor Matsuzawa is famous for his research on chimpanzee cognition, combining a long-term study of chimpanzees in the wild and testing them in captivity (the Ai project). His findings demonstrate the sophisticated cognitive abilities of chimpanzees that have had important welfare consequences (e.g. adding to the evidence underpinning changes to their use in research and testing).
